Key skills for this role
5-10 years of recent experience completing operating expense reconciliation reviews, resolving disputes with landlords, and conducting complete lease audits in commercial real estate; office lease audits is preferred.
Strong working knowledge of lease audit mechanics including base year calculations, gross-up provisions, expense exclusions, controllable caps, audit rights, dispute periods, amortization or capital expenses and statute of limitations.
Obtain detailed documentation to validate the expenses charged, and provide clear, well-supported audit results with detailed explanations to clients and landlords.
Demonstrated track record of successfully negotiating and resolving disputes with landlords/property managers, including recovery of overcharges resulting from audit findings.
Tracking recoveries, future savings and value-added benefit for all reviews and audits.
Proficient in preparing and distributing monthly, quarterly, and year-end reports in a timely and accurate manner.
Strong relationship-building skills with clients, landlords, the Lease Administration team, and internal partners, with professional communication to resolve issues and answer lease-related questions.
Proficient in interpreting and abstracting complex lease documents (international leases a plus), through careful review of clients' legal documentation.
Impeccable attention to detail and exacting standards for data accuracy, lease knowledge, and follow-up.
Able to enthusiastically approach challenges and work independently, managing competing priorities with minimal supervision.
Bachelor's degree is preferred in accounting, real estate or related field from accredited university or college required.
CPA designation a plus.
Prior team or process management experience a plus.
Strong Microsoft Office proficiency, specifically in Excel.
